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Revenue Recovery In 2025A top-line rebound in 2025 after prior contractions indicates the company can regain growth momentum. This durable improvement suggests product-market fit or sales traction returned, offering a realistic path to scale revenue and absorb fixed costs if the trend persists over multiple quarters.
Positive Gross Profit BaseMaintaining a positive gross profit means core unit economics remain favorable despite operating losses. That structural profit on revenue gives management room to focus on operating leverage and SG&A discipline to move toward operating profitability as revenues scale.
Improving Leverage And Balance-sheet StabilizationThe rebound in equity and declining total debt materially reduce immediate solvency risk versus the 2024 stress period. A more normalized leverage profile increases financial flexibility to fund operations or strategic investments without an imminent liquidity crisis, a durable improvement.
Bears Say
Sustained Negative Cash FlowPersistent negative operating and free cash flow is a fundamental weakness: the business is not self-funding and will need external capital or significant margin/revenue improvement. Continued cash burn erodes runway and forces trade-offs between growth, product investment, and solvency over the medium term.
Multi-year Losses And Compressed MarginsOngoing net losses and materially compressed gross and operating margins signal weak operating leverage and deteriorating unit economics. If margins do not recover, profitability will remain elusive despite revenue gains, limiting sustainable free cash generation and shareholder returns.
Volatile Revenue HistorySharp revenue swings make forecasting, capacity planning, and long-term investment decisions difficult. Structural volatility suggests inconsistent demand or execution, raising the risk that the 2025 rebound is temporary rather than the start of a sustained, predictable growth trajectory.

                  Company Description

                  G-NEXT, Inc.

                  G-NEXT Inc. develops cloud-based SaaS platform for customer support in corporate issues. Its products include CRMotion to offer customer services; and BizCRM, BizVoice, BizKnowledge Mining, BizKnowledge QADoc, and BizMail to provide customer contact services. The company was founded in 2001 and is based in Tokyo, Japan.
